Sir Walter Raleigh's plan in 1584 for colonization in the "Colony and Dominion of Virginia" (which included the present-day states of North Carolina and Virginia) in North America ended in failure at Roanoke Island, but paved the way for subsequent colonies. The state capital of North Carolina was named in 1792 for Sir Walter Raleigh, sponsor of the Colony of Roanoke. Gosse’s biography was the first attempt to portray his personal career apart from the general history of his time. At the time of original publication Edmund Gosse was Clark Lecturer in English Literature at Trinity College, Cambridge. (Introduction by Wikipedia and Eugene Smith.) (7 hr 43 min)
